Blinker switch
Just yesterday my left blinker won't turn off after I turn... The right does just not the left. Any ideas on this? The arm on the steering wheel is very loose as well

You need to get through step 17 in this thread to replace the springs: https://ls1tech.com/forums/general-m...mn-repair.html
Step 20 shows a picture of the springs. One cancels the turn signal for left and the other is right.
While you are in there, you should:
- Also replace the turn signal cam as shown in Step 17.
- Lube the white plastic parts and metal strips shown in Step 19 with white lithium grease.
If you replace the springs, cam, and lube - your turn signals should be set for a long time.
